Why this matters
Insurance runs on regulated, structured, and messy data at the same time — policy admin exports, PDF schedules, adjuster notes, and core systems like Guidewire or Duck Creek that weren't built with AI agents in mind. The FCA's Consumer Duty rules, in force since July 2023, put explainability and fair-outcome evidence on every automated decision touching a customer. IFRS 17, effective from January 2023, tightened how insurers have to account for and report on policy data quality.
That combination is why generic AI tooling stalls in insurance faster than almost any other sector. A custom AI product agency that understands claims and underwriting workflows builds systems that pass an audit trail review; a chatbot vendor building the same feature for retail doesn't.

What to look for in a custom AI development partner for insurance
Domain fluency in claims and underwriting workflows
A partner who's never seen a FNOL form or a bordereau will spend your first sprint learning insurance instead of shipping. Ask for specifics on how they've handled policy admin data before, not general AI capability slides.
Data governance and explainability by design
Every automated decision touching a policyholder needs an audit trail under Consumer Duty. If explainability is an afterthought bolted on post-launch, the system will fail compliance review before it fails technically.
Build speed from prototype to production
Insurance AI projects that take six months to reach a live pilot lose executive sponsorship before they prove value. The right partner moves from prototype to production in weeks, not quarters — that's the difference between a system that ships and a deck that gets shelved.
Integration with legacy core systems
Guidewire, Sapiens, Duck Creek, and homegrown policy admin platforms weren't designed for AI agents to read and write against. A partner who hasn't integrated with at least one of these will underestimate your actual timeline by months.
Ownership model, not a black box
If the agency retains the IP, the model weights, or the only working knowledge of how the system runs, you've bought a dependency, not a capability. Systems your team owns outlast any single vendor relationship.
Willingness to start narrow
The insurers who get value from AI in 2026 pick one workflow — claims triage, underwriting copilot, fraud flagging — and prove it before expanding. A partner pushing a platform-wide rollout on day one is selling software, not solving your problem.
Where to focus your first build
Claims triage agent — the fastest payback. Routes first-notice-of-loss submissions to the right adjuster queue based on claim type, severity signals, and policy terms, instead of a human reading every intake form. This is the workflow with the clearest before/after: manual triage queues shrink because the agent does the sorting, not the deciding. Verdict: Buy — build this first.
Underwriting copilot — the wildcard. Surfaces relevant policy history, risk factors, and prior submissions to underwriters at the point of decision, cutting the research time before a quote goes out. This only works once the underlying data feeds are clean — a copilot built on messy source data just automates bad guesses faster. Verdict: Consider — sequence this after your data audit, not before it.
Fraud detection flagging — the compliance-sensitive pick. Flags anomalous claims patterns for human review rather than auto-denying them, which keeps you inside Consumer Duty's fair-outcome requirements. Full automation of fraud denial is the one place where a black-box model creates real regulatory exposure. Verdict: Buy, but only with a human-in-the-loop step built in from day one.
Policy document processing — the quiet workhorse. Extracts structured data from PDFs, scanned schedules, and legacy policy documents so downstream systems stop choking on unstructured input. It's not glamorous, but every other AI system in this list depends on this data being usable. Verdict: Buy if your claims or underwriting builds are stalling on data quality.
Customer-facing chat agent — the one to sequence last. Answers policyholder queries about claim status or coverage using the same underlying data as your internal systems. Building this before your internal workflows are solid means the agent gives confident wrong answers with a friendly UI on top. Verdict: Skip until claims triage and document processing are live.
What to avoid
- Generic chatbot platforms rebadged for insurance. They look like a fast win in a demo and fail the moment a policyholder asks a coverage question the vendor never trained for.
- Vendor lock-in on model or data. If you can't export your data, retrain the model elsewhere, or hand the codebase to an internal team, you've rented a feature, not built a capability.
- Full automation of anything customer-facing without a human-in-the-loop step. Consumer Duty doesn't ban AI decisions — it bans AI decisions you can't explain.

FAQ
What is custom AI development for insurance companies?
It's the design and build of AI agents and workflows tailored to an insurer's own claims, underwriting, or fraud processes, rather than a generic off-the-shelf tool. In 2026 this usually means a system that reads existing policy admin data and slots into workflows adjusters and underwriters already use.
How long does it take to build a custom AI system for an insurer?
A narrow, single-workflow build like claims triage can go from prototype to production in weeks with the right partner, not the four-to-six month cycle common with larger platform rollouts. Timelines stretch when legacy core system integration or data cleanup is needed first.
Is a custom AI agent better than an off-the-shelf chatbot for insurance?
For anything touching claims decisions, underwriting, or policyholder communication, yes — off-the-shelf chatbots weren't built to meet Consumer Duty's explainability requirements. Custom systems can be built with an audit trail from day one, which generic tools rarely support.
Does Consumer Duty affect AI systems built for insurance?
Yes. Consumer Duty, in force since July 2023, requires insurers to evidence fair outcomes for customers, which extends to any automated decision a customer is subject to. Any AI system making or influencing claims or underwriting decisions needs an explainability layer to pass review.
Which insurance workflow should be automated with AI first?
Claims triage — routing first-notice-of-loss submissions to the right queue — has the clearest payback because it replaces a manual sorting task without touching the final decision. Underwriting copilots and fraud detection should follow once data feeds are clean.
Can custom AI integrate with legacy insurance core systems like Guidewire?
Yes, but it depends on the build partner having done it before. Guidewire, Duck Creek, and Sapiens integrations are the most common bottleneck in insurance AI projects, and a partner without prior experience will underestimate the timeline.
What's the risk of building AI for fraud detection in insurance?
The main risk is full automation of claim denials without a human-in-the-loop step, which creates exposure under Consumer Duty's fair-outcome rules. Flagging anomalies for human review, rather than auto-denying, keeps the system compliant.

One last thing
The biggest blocker to custom AI development for insurance companies in 2026 usually isn't the model — it's document quality. Policy schedules, adjuster notes, and scanned bordereaux are still the reason most claims and underwriting AI builds stall in month two, long before anyone questions the model's accuracy. Fix the document processing layer first and every system built on top of it moves faster.
